DESCRIPTION

This unit consists of a specialised study of a Latin author or aspect of Roman literature.

WEIGHT:  12.5%

ASSESSMENT: 3,000 word essay (40%) three-hour exam (60%)

TEACHING PATTERN: nt: Seminars and supervisions, 2 hrs per week
